When the two equations are graphed on a coordinate plane, they intersect at two points.
Law Incorporation [45]

Answer:

(0,4) and (-2,0)

Step-by-step explanation:

y=3x²+4x+4

y = -2x +4

3x²+4x+4 = - 2x +4

3x²+6x=0

3x(x+2)=0

x=0, x= -2

x=0, y=-2x+4= -2*0 + 4 =4,   (0,4)

x= - 2, y = 2x + 4= 2*(-2) +4=0,    (-2,0)

What must be added to 3x-7 to make x^2 +4x-1 ?
Snowcat [4.5K]
<span> x²+4x-1 - (3x - 7) = x² + 4x - 1 - 3x +7 = x² + x + 6

</span>x² + x + 6 should be added to 3x - 7  to make  x²+4x-1.
